Nov 23, 2023 · Stocks are bought and sold in order to earn money. The underlying logic is quite simple—you buy a stock for a certain price, wait for the price to go up, and then you sell it and keep the difference. This is commonly referred to as buying low and selling high. The very basic concept of buying low and selling high. Jan 19, 2022 · If you buy the stock on Friday, March 15, you will get the $1 dividend because the stock is trading with (or "cum") dividend.
